Rajnikant is the emperor: Amitabh Bachchan
Jun 21, 2007 IANSMumbai, June 22 (IANS) Amitabh Bachchan, who calls Rajnikant the true emperor of Indian cinema, admires the Tamil superstar for his simplicity, humility and the way he has brought up his children.
Reacting to Rajnikant's remark about himself and the Big B being the king and the emperor respectively, Bachchan told IANS: "Rajni is phenomenal. The largest, the best and truly the boss! It is ridiculous to compare me with him.
"Outside of Tamil Nadu, people have no idea whatsoever what he is all about. The adulation, the following is incomparable. We are friends, colleagues. His modesty is legendary. His simplicity in his existence and in his demeanour is also legendary.
"Don't believe a word of this 'king' and 'emperor' thing. We all know that he is The Emperor. I abhor epithets, but for him I will make exceptions, for he is truly exceptional."
Bachchan has made a rare guest appearance in a regional film - the Rajnikant-starrer "Shivaji The Boss".
Says the Big B: "I had done the guest appearance in (Kannada film) 'Amruthdhare' at a friend's request. In this case, the producer of 'Shivaji' bought the rights of a film of mine that had closed shop due to financial constraints.
"In return, I was required to work as a guest in the film being made with Rajnikant. That's how it happened. And thank god it did. I remember Rajni starred in the Hindi film 'Andha Kanoon', which had me in one of the most dynamic guest appearances of my life."
The Big B is full of admiration for what Rajnikant has achieved.
"Look where he came from and what he has become. Sheer hard work, talent and the belief that he could do it... and he did! Such a fantastic example for any youth in any part of the world!
"Despite his extraordinary career he has remained that simple, down to earth person he was when he started off. All his people around him are friends that were with him when he was a nobody."
The Big B reveals touching details from the Tamil superstar's life.
"Do you know, a Fiat car that he bought when he had attained his early success still remains with him and he only uses that car to date? He's a humble human being and a caring and considerate co-star.
"Rajni is terrific company on the sets and a fine gentleman. He's religious, traditional and charitable. Most importantly, he along with his equally modest wife have brought up their two daughters well.
"His daughters are a reflection of him. To me, the way your offspring turn out is the truest reflection of your achievements."
